Job Description

The Planning Clerk will assist in the Quarterly, Monthly and Daily planning processes to help ensure optimal plans are established for the manufacturing of products such that materials can be purchased, arrive as desired and manufacturing is able to build the right product at the right time to ultimately fill customer orders on time in the most cost- effective manner and maintain the desired level of inventory

Duties & Responsibilities:

  • Request and /or generate production orders for assemblies and sub-assemblies according to the build plan requirement.
  • Make the analysis of the build plan requirement vs current capacity, in order to escalate if there is any constraint.
  • Supports the forecasting process to define the overall demand plan. Ensures that the agreed upon demand plan is loaded in Rapid Response and other production planning tools are developed and maintained to support the timely production of product to meet customer requirements and maintain the desired amount of inventory.
  • Helps develop new product production demand plans to support new product launch plans while minimizing scrap of phased out products.
  • Collaborates, builds and maintains relationships with business partners (e.g. Sales, Marketing, Document Control, Engineering, Finance, Purchasing, Production Planning, Quality Assurance) to gain insight on requirements to sales activities, market trends and capacity status such that the best possible plans can be developed and executed.
  • Monitors and reports forecast accuracy, implementing necessary action items to drive improvement.
  • Works closely with the Operation team to track and improve the demand plan vs. capacity requirements to ensure the company is growing the capacity to meet the demand requirements.
  • Works closely with Engineering, Purchasing, Production and Distribution to coordinate the implementation of change orders, ensure production happens in a timely manner and specific customer orders are shipped on time.
  • Identifies forecast issues, trends and gaps and conducts analysis. Results are discussed with the SCM Manager, Sales and Operations Planning to improve the overall S&OP process
  • Performs special projects as requested.
  • Any activity related to the supply chain.
